Delay-Differentiated Scheduling in Optical Packet Switches for Cloud Data Centers

作者:Li Yaofang; Xiao Jie; Wu Bin*; Wen Hong; Yu Hongfang; Yang Shu; Xin Shanshan; Guo Jianing
来源:China Communications, 2015, 12(8): 22-32.
DOI:10.1109/CC.2015.7224703

摘要

We consider differentiated time-critical task scheduling in a NxN input queued optical packet switch to ensure 100% throughput and meet different delay requirements among various modules of data center. Existing schemes either consider slot-by-slot scheduling with queue depth serving as the delay metric or assume that each input-output connection has the same delay bound in the batch scheduling mode. The former scheme neglects the effect of reconfiguration overhead, which may result in crippled system performance, while the latter cannot satisfy users' differentiated Quality of Service (QoS) requirements. To make up these deficiencies, we propose a new batch scheduling scheme to meet the various port-to-port delay requirements in a best-effort manner. Moreover, a speedup is considered to compensate for both the reconfiguration overhead and the unavoidable slots wastage in the switch fabric. With traffic matrix and delay constraint matrix given, this paper proposes two heuristic algorithms Stringent Delay First (SDF) and m-order SDF(m-SDF) to realize the 100% packet switching, while maximizing the delay constraints satisfaction ratio. The performance of our scheme is verified by extensive numerical simulations.